この短いトピックでは、Java で MBOX を PST ファイルに変換する方法について説明します。これには、環境をセットアップするためのすべての詳細と、タスクを実行するための完全なプログラム フローが含まれます。数行のコードを使用して簡単にJava で MBOX を PST ファイルに保存し、Windows、macOS、Linux などの Java がサポートされている環境でこのアプリケーションを使用できます。
JavaでMBOXをPSTファイルに変換する手順
- Maven リポジトリから Aspose.Email for Java JAR ファイルを含めるように開発環境をセットアップします
- PersonalStorage クラス インスタンスを使用して、ディスク上に PST ストレージ ファイルを作成します
- PST 内にカスタム受信トレイ フォルダーを追加する
- MboxrdStorageReader クラスを使用し、MBOX ロード オプションを指定して、ディスクからソース MBOX ファイルを開きます。
- MBOX 内の各メッセージを繰り返し処理し、それを目的の PST フォルダー内に挿入します。
前述の手順は、Java を使用して MBOX から PST を作成する ための詳細を提供します。このプロセスは、PersonalStorage クラス インスタンスを使用して、その中に受信トレイ フォルダーと共に空の PST ストレージ ファイルを作成することによって開始されます。最後に、MboxrdStorageReader クラス オブジェクトを使用してディスクからソース MBOX ファイルを開いた後、MBOX ファイル内のメッセージは MailMessage クラスを使用して繰り返され、PST フォルダー内に保存されます。
Java を使用して MBOX から PST を作成するコード
この例は、MBOX から PST へのコンバーターを開発するために、単純な API 呼び出しを利用して Java ベースの API を使用できることを示しています。これは、最初のステップで、それぞれの受信トレイ フォルダーを含む PST ストレージ ファイルがディスク上に作成される簡単なプロセスです。その後、MBOX ファイルのメッセージが繰り返され、ディスクからロードされた後、PST フォルダー内に保存されます。
この例では、単純な API インターフェイスを使用して、Java MBOX から PST へのコンバーター アプリケーションをいかに簡単に作成できるかを調べました。 Java を使用して PST ファイルを複数の PST ファイルに分割する方法に関心がある場合は、Javaを使用してPSTファイルを分割する方法 に関する記事を参照してください。